A Pantheon Macro chief British economist, Rob Wood, said in a report on March 6 that British enterprises' expectations for inflation one year later rose from 3.0% in January to 3.1% in February, indicating that the downward trend in inflation has ended. He said, "According to data from the Banco Central decision-making group in the UK, as enterprises pass on wage tax increases and US President Trump's tariff threats to prices, the anti-inflation trend has ended." The Banco Central decision-making group survey also shows that enterprises expect the interest rate of Banco Central to drop from the current 4.5% to 3.9% in one year.
